Bruins drop third straight
Boston fell by a 5-2 score Monday night at Ottawa to drop to 20-5-6 on the season. The Bruins trailed 2-0 in the first period before Patrice Bergeron put them on the board at the 2:22 mark off assists from David Pastrnak and Brad Marchand. The Senators extended their advantage to 4-1 in the third period, but a power play goal from Jake DeBrusk with 2:15 remaining on assists by Pastrnak and Marchand trimmed it to 4-2. Ottawa added its final goal with one second left. Tuukka Rask allowed three goals on 26 shots in the defeat.
Caps have six-game win streak snapped
Washington lost 5-2 at home Monday night versus Columbus to fall to 22-5-5 on the season. The Capitals trailed 2-0 until Alex Ovechkin cut the deficit in half 40 seconds into the third period off assists from Dmitry Orlov and Nicklas Backstrom. The Blue Jackets extended it to 4-1 midway through the third, but Backstrom made it 4-2 with 2:06 remaining on a tally assisted by Ovechkin and Evgeny Kuznetsov. Columbus added its final goal 16 seconds later. Braden Holtby surrendered four goals on 37 shots in the losing effort.
